Katy Perry Reflects on Pregnancy With Daughter Daisy Dove

Katy Perry incessantly prefers to stay her daughter, Daisy Love Bloom, out of the highlight.

But the arriving of Mother’s Day on Sunday, May 12, sparked a second of delight as the singer, 39, took to social media to gush about expecting the coming of her 3-year-old.

Perry took to Instagram to submit a carousel of pictures and videos including a snap of her pregnancy check, her growing bump, the instant she shared the news with fiancé Orlando Bloom, a clip from a pregnancy ultrasound and a video that confirmed the moment she shared the inside track with her American Idol co-judges Lionel Richie and Luke Bryan.

“Today I informed my mother that the day I realized how a lot she beloved me is the day I had my very own daughter, Daisy Dove,” Perry captioned the Mother’s Day post. “There is nothing like a Mother’s love. Never take it without any consideration. Happy Mother’s Day to the entire moms and caretakers — any approach you come back.”

She also captioned each of the images and the 2 clips.

Perry wrote, “1. Og pee stick! 2. Telling O I was pregnant (he used to be filming in Prague) 3. Telling my brothers @lukebryan @lionelrichie the big news on set in Hawaii at #idol 4. Hearing Daisy’s heartbeat for the primary time 5-10: Some bump pics from earlier than I met my Daisy Dove.”

The “Firework” hitmaker gave birth to her daughter in August, 2020 and announced her child’s arrival into the world by way of UNICEF, an organization of which Perry and Bloom, 47, serve as Goodwill Ambassadors.
